An illustrated history of blues music, featuringblues artists of every era, over 350 stunning photographs and illustrations, and a wealth of rare graphic memorabilia

Foreword by Marshall Chess, veteran record producer with legendary Chicago rhythm-and-blues label, Chess Records

The deceptively simple, 12-bar musical form of blues has become the common denominator that has driven the popular music of the last hundred years. As John Lee Hooker put it: The music we play . . . that music is the roots. Rock music, everything else, is like a branch on the same tree. It all comes from the blues.

Charting the history of blues music from its rural roots in the American South, and focusing on the key musicians and singers who brought it recognition worldwide, The Blues: A Visual History is a unique and fully illustrated account of the development of the blues, and features:

350 stunning photographs and illustrations
A wealth of archive photography
Rare graphic memorabilia
Blues artists of every era, from pioneers like Ma Rainey and Robert Johnson, through legends such as Muddy Waters and B. B. King, to newer stars like Keb’ Mo’, Dom Flemons, and Shemekia Copeland
Foreword by Marshall Chess, veteran record producer with his familys legendary Chicago rhythm-and-blues label, Chess Records
